Abstract
I will present measurements of the star formation histories of ~40 z~1
galaxies with strong Balmer absorption lines indicating recent and rapid
quenching of star formation, alongside well defined control samples of
star-forming and quiescent galaxies. High quality VLT spectra and
multiwavelength photometry, combined with a comparison between both
state-of-the-art Bayesian parameterised and unparameterised SFH model
fitting, provide tight constraints on physical properties such as the
age and strength of the starburst, and fraction of old stars. A
significant fraction are consistent with being close to single-epoch
burst events with peak star formation rates consistent with sub-mm
galaxies. This data provides a perfect example of the science that will
